In a cyclotron the frequency of alternating current is 12 MHz and the radii of its dee is `0.53m`. What should be the operating magnetic field to accelerate protons ? Given mass of proton `=1.67xx10^(-27)` kg and charge `=+1.6xx10^(-19)C`.

condition of resonance,
`(1)/(2pi)((q)/(m))B=n_(0) or, B=(2pi n_(0)m)/(q)`
Here, `n_(0)=12MHz=12xx10^(6) Hz=12xx10^(6)s^(-1)`
So, `B=(2xx3.14xx (12xx16^(6))xx(1.67xx10^(-27)))/(1.6xx10^(-19))`
`=0.79Wb*m^(-2)`
